1901 Halftone Print Portrait William Wordsworth Romantic Age English Lake XGGA4 XGYA2 After its many acquisitions theThis is an original 1901 black and white halftone print of English poet and writer William Wordsworth of the Romantic movement. In the late 18th century he moved to the Lake District of Cumbria, England with other prominent writers Coleridge and Southey and would become part of the English Lake Poets. The Literary Association of the English Lakes or the English Lake Poets were a collection poets and writers who lived in the picturesque Lake District
